“…Our previous findings showed that 14-3-3γ could positively affect mTOR pathway (Yu et al 2014), which is essential for milk protein synthesis in dairy cow (Bionaz and Loor 2011;Zhang et al 2014). Further study on the immunoprecipitation of 14-3-3γ with 44 proteins in bovine mammary epithelial cells (BMECs) revealed that 14-3-3γ could interact with and positively affect the expression of eIF1AX (eukaryotic translation initiation factor 1A, X-linked) and RPS7 (ribosomal protein S7) to enhance milk protein synthesis (Yu et al 2014). These results suggest that 14-3-3γ is an important signaling molecule for milk protein synthesis through interacting with and regulating eIF1AX and RPS7 in the translational level.…”

“…Recent studies in bovines have highlighted a role of mTOR in the regulation of milk synthesis (Zhang et al, 2014), including milk protein synthesis (Wang et al, 2014b; Yu et al, 2014) and triacylglycerol or FAs synthesis (Li et al, 2014). Compared with untreated control cells, rapamycin reduced triglyceride secretion of BMECs (Zhang et al, 2014).…”
